Elevate Your Floors with Crystal Clear Polyurethane Paint
Give your floors a stunning new look and durable protection with crystal clear polyurethane paint. This versatile finish accentuates the natural beauty of your flooring, revealing its true charm. Whether you have hardwood, laminate, or tile floors, polyurethane paint provides a high-gloss shield that resists scratches, stains, and daily wear and tear. Applying polyurethane is a relatively easy process, even for DIY enthusiasts. Simply prepare your floors by cleaning and sanding them thoroughly, then apply multiple coats of the clear polyurethane paint according to the manufacturer's instructions. With proper care and maintenance, your newly coated floors will shine for years to come.

Picking the Right PU Floor Paint for Your Needs
Finding the ideal polyurethane (PU) floor paint can be a daunting task. With so many , varieties offered, it's easy to get lost. However, by analyzing your specific needs and expectations, you will surely pick the perfect PU floor paint for your task.
First, determine the type of surface you're . coating. Different floor paints are designed for specific surfaces such as wood, concrete, or metal.
Next, think about the level of resistance you want. Some PU paints offer increased scratch resistance, suited for high-traffic areas.
If your project demands exposure pu flooring to moisture or water, select a PU paint with moisture-resistant . features.
Finally, remember your aesthetic choices. PU paints offer a wide variety of colors and , sheens, allowing you to tailor the look of your surface.
